在CentOS上設置C++編譯器的路徑,通常是指配置環境變量以便在終端中直接使用g++或clang++等命令。以下是設置C++路徑的步驟:
安裝C++編譯器:
如果你還沒有安裝C++編譯器,你可以使用以下命令來安裝gcc-c++包,它包含了g++編譯器:
sudo yum install gcc-c++
對于clang++,你可以使用以下命令來安裝:
sudo yum install clang
找到編譯器的路徑:
通常情況下,安裝后的編譯器會自動添加到系統的PATH環境變量中。你可以通過以下命令來檢查g++是否已經在PATH中:
which g++
如果輸出類似于/usr/bin/g++的路徑,那么g++已經在PATH中了。如果沒有輸出或者路徑不是/usr/bin/g++,你可能需要手動添加路徑。
設置環境變量:
如果需要手動設置環境變量,你可以編輯~/.bashrc文件(或者~/.bash_profile,取決于你的系統配置)來添加編譯器的路徑。使用文本編輯器打開文件:
nano ~/.bashrc
在文件的末尾添加以下行(如果g++的路徑不是/usr/bin/g++):
export PATH=$PATH:/path/to/your/compiler
將/path/to/your/compiler替換為實際的編譯器路徑。
保存并關閉文件后,運行以下命令使更改生效:
source ~/.bashrc
現在你應該可以在終端中使用g++或clang++命令了。
驗證設置:
最后,你可以通過運行以下命令來驗證g++是否已經正確設置:
g++ --version
如果安裝正確,你應該能看到編譯器的版本信息。
請注意,如果你是在特定的目錄下工作,你可能需要在該目錄的.bashrc或.bash_profile中設置環境變量,或者使用絕對路徑來調用編譯器。此外,如果你使用的是其他shell(如zsh),則需要編輯相應的配置文件(如~/.zshrc)。